Output 7e58573ee44733a1e66a5b138c6e81244a4317e875685d6c4437747b258404d2:3

value
42718838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10e148d160bec44bb9f8c44ce0838cddddb842d OP_EQUAL
address
3LkQ1x7yE6X4h38sUAEKe4m1mTtGSXfmcL
transaction
7e58573ee44733a1e66a5b138c6e81244a4317e875685d6c4437747b258404d2
spent
true